The Nativity story is about Mary, a virgin, who was chosen by God. An angel, Gabriel, came to her and told her she would conceive a son by the Holy Spirit. Joseph, her betrothed, was a righteous man. When he found out Mary was pregnant, an angel also appeared to him in a dream and told him not to be afraid. Mary and Joseph had to travel to Bethlehem for a census. When they got there, there was no room at the inn, so Jesus was born in a manger. This is the core of the Christmas story as it marks the birth of Jesus, the Savior.

The three Kings in the Nativity story were Magi. They were wise men from the East. But the Bible doesn't actually say they were kings. They are often depicted as kings in art and tradition because of their royal gifts and their importance in the story.
The main characters in the Nativity story are Mary, Joseph, Jesus, the shepherds, and the wise men. Mary was the virgin who gave birth to Jesus. Joseph was her husband who took care of them. Jesus was the Son of God born in Bethlehem. The shepherds were the first to be informed by the angels about Jesus' birth and came to see him. The wise men followed a star to find Jesus and brought gifts.
